A \"Tasting Party\" at the start of the program allows children to try different foods, and Veggie Meter scans at the beginning and end of the study help track changes in fruit and vegetable intake.\n\nOverall, this study will help determine whether a family-tailored physical activity program is a promising approach to improving physical activity, movement skills, and early health indicators in young children born to mothers with obesity.",[263],"Physical Activities",[265,266,267,268,269],"Preschool children","Early childhood","Physical activity intervention","Gross motor skills","Motor development","2026-01-21",{"date":272,"type":31},"2026-01-22",{"date":274,"type":31},"2025-07-28",{"date":276,"type":22},"2031-07-01",{"name":37,"class":38},{"id":279,"slug":280,"hasResults":11,"nctId":281,"briefTitle":282,"officialTitle":283,"acronym":4,"eligibilityCriteria":284,"healthyVolunteers":11,"sex":199,"minAge":200,"maxAge":4,"enrollmentInfo":285,"targetDuration":4,"studyType":81,"phases":287,"briefSummary":288,"conditions":289,"keywords":290,"overallStatus":27,"whyStopped":4,"lastUpdateSubmitDate":296,"lastUpdatePostDateStruct":297,"startDateStruct":299,"completionDateStruct":301,"leadSponsor":302,"locationsCount":39},"100619367","community-expecting-exercise-during-pregnancy-100619367","NCT07343700","Community Expecting: Exercise During Pregnancy","Community Expecting: Exercise During Pregnancy for Sedentary Women With Obesity","Inclusion Criteria:\n\n* 18 years of age or older\n* Having a BMI ≥ 30\n* Not currently meeting guidelines for 150 min of moderate physical activity per week.\n* All children born to mother participants will be included and eligible.\n\nExclusion Criteria:\n\n* Non-English speaking individuals.\n* Contraindications for exercise (preeclampsia-eclampsia, premature rupture of the membranes, antepartum hemorrhage, placenta previa, or multiple gestation),) as determined by the investigators to affect the outcomes of interest\n* Using recreational drugs, tobacco, or alcohol during their pregnancy.\n* \\\u003C 11 or \\> 16 weeks gestation",{"count":286,"type":22},228,[150],"Regular physical activity during pregnancy is safe and offers many health benefits for both mothers and their babies. Research over the past decade shows that exercise can help pregnant women gain a healthy amount of weight, lower their risk of gestational diabetes and high blood pressure, and reduce stress, anxiety, and symptoms of postpartum depression. Babies also benefit when their mothers are active, with lower risks of preterm birth, unhealthy birth size, and childhood obesity.\n\nDespite this strong evidence, very few exercise programs for pregnant women have been tested in real-world community settings, such as fitness centers, community health programs, or local organizations. Even fewer studies explain how these programs were delivered or what helped them succeed. Without this information, it is difficult for communities and health programs to offer exercise support that is both effective and practical for pregnant women.\n\nTo address this gap, the research team adapted an evidence-based program called EXPECTING so it could be delivered by community organizations. Previous participants and community advisors helped to understand what changes were needed to make the program easier to offer while still keeping it safe and effective. The core parts of the program, including the type, amount, and intensity of aerobic and strength-building exercises, remained the same and are based on established pregnancy exercise guidelines.\n\nThe adapted program, called COMMUNITY EXPECTING, includes both aerobic exercise and resistance training. The research team also developed specific supports to help community instructors deliver the program consistently and with confidence. All program components have already been tested in community settings and shown to be realistic, acceptable, and delivered as planned.\n\nThis study will examine whether offering a structured exercise program in community settings helps pregnant women be more physically active than usual prenatal care alone. We will also assess whether the program can be delivered successfully and in a way that works for both participants and community providers. The results will help determine whether COMMUNITY EXPECTING is a practical approach for supporting healthy pregnancies in real-world settings.",[263],[291,292,293,294,295],"Pregnancy","Prenatal Exercise","Prenatal fitness","Community","Implementation","2026-01-08",{"date":298,"type":31},"2026-01-15",{"date":300,"type":31},"2025-05-30",{"date":276,"type":22},{"name":37,"class":38},{"id":304,"slug":305,"hasResults":11,"nctId":306,"briefTitle":307,"officialTitle":308,"acronym":309,"eligibilityCriteria":310,"healthyVolunteers":198,"sex":17,"minAge":311,"maxAge":312,"enrollmentInfo":313,"targetDuration":4,"studyType":81,"phases":315,"briefSummary":316,"conditions":317,"keywords":4,"overallStatus":27,"whyStopped":4,"lastUpdateSubmitDate":319,"lastUpdatePostDateStruct":320,"startDateStruct":322,"completionDateStruct":324,"leadSponsor":326,"locationsCount":39},"100406516","protein-requirements-for-active-children-100406516","NCT04573439","Protein Requirements for Active Children","Children's Protein Requirements With Physical Activity: The ChiPP Study","ChiPP","Inclusion Criteria:\n\n* Inclusion Criteria\n\n  * Boys or girls\n  * Ages 8-10 years\n  * All races\n  * All ethnicities\n  * Children who were determined to have normal weight (BMI \\\u003C85th percentile) already determined under Mitochondria (MI) Energy (IRB Protocol: 260376)\n  * Participants willing to stop taking nutritional supplements (e.g., multivitamins, vitamin D, fish oil, probiotics, prebiotics, immune boosters, and others) for at least 2 weeks prior to each study testing visit\n  * Children without an infection requiring antibiotics willing to be rescheduled after at least 2 months of finalizing antibiotic treatment.\n  * Children without viral infections such as diarrhea, cold, or flu willing to be rescheduled after at least 2 weeks of resolution of symptoms.\n  * Children determined sedentary or active, based on both peak oxygen uptake (VO2) and accelerometer data, as described below: Children who completed a peak fitness test during MI Energy (IRB Protocol: 260376), and for whom peak VO2 data are as follows:\n\nPeak ⩒O2, ml·min-1·fat free mass index (FFMI)-1 Boys Girls Boys Girls\n\n* 89 ≤ 80 ≥115 ≥105 FFMI, fat-free mass index\n\nAND\n\nChildren who completed accelerometer measures during MI Energy (IRB Protocol: 260376), and for whom average daily activity counts and\u002For minutes of moderate to vigorous physical activity are as follow:\n\nSedentary Active Activity counts\u002Fday \\\u003C2,924,494 ≥3,767,075 Minutes of Moderate to vigorous physical activity\u002Fday \\\u003C60 ≥60\n\nChildren who completed National Survey of Children's Health and Youth Risk Behavior Survey (NSCH-YRBS) questionnaire during MI Energy study (IRB Protocol: 260376). The insertion procedure for IUDs can be uncomfortable and painful. Sedation may be needed to improve patient comfort. The use of IUDs is increasing in the adolescent population, but perceived pain is a barrier to placement.\n\nPropofol is a commonly used agent for pediatric procedural sedation, but it has no analgesic properties. Ketorolac, a nonsteroidal anti-inflammatory drug, has been shown to reduce pain in adults and improve patient satisfaction when used prior to IUD placement..\n\nThe current study aims to determine if ketorolac, given in combination with propofol for IUD placement in adolescents, can improve comfort during placement and reduce pain following the procedure. Enrolled patients will receive ketorolac or placebo, in addition to propofol, for IUD placement. By comparing the outcomes of these two groups of patients, we can gain a better understanding of the optimal approach to sedation for IUD insertion in adolescents.",[565,566,567,568],"IUD","Healthy Female","Contraception","IUD Insertion Complication","2024-07-30",{"date":571,"type":31},"2024-07-31",{"date":573,"type":31},"2024-02-05",{"date":575,"type":22},"2025-06",{"name":37,"class":38},""]
